In 2019, Tamara, then a mother of a one-year-old and a new baby, needed to leave an abusive relationship. She reached out to Feet of Clay.
FoC helped her find resources including a shelter where Tamara and her two sons could be safe as she began putting her life back together, and an organization that would provide housing assistance once she found an apartment.
FoC helped Tamara with healing mentally and emotionally from the abuse.
To raise domestic violence awareness, Tamara is now working on a book about her experience. She plans to include excerpts from the journal.
Today, Tamara and her sons are thriving. She is a busy small business owner.
In her spare time, Tamara enjoys working with FoC, giving back to the organization that helped her.
